Turkish authorities crack down on Christianity; deny church land for worship space

The Diyarbakir Protestant Church Foundation, established in 2019 to serve Protestant Christians in one of Turkey’s southeastern major cities, is facing overt discrimination from the government as they struggle to acquire land zoned for religious buildings to construct a new worship center.
